Understanding the Basics of DIY Solar Panel Systems

Before diving into the process of building your own solar panel system, it’s essential to understand how these systems work. A typical solar power system consists of solar panels, an inverter, and a battery storage system. Solar panels convert sunlight into electricity, the inverter changes this electricity into a usable form, and battery storage allows you to use this energy even when the sun isn’t shining.

Step-by-Step Guide to Building a DIY Solar Panel System in Cold Weather

  1. Research Local Regulations: Check with your local authorities about any permits or regulations regarding solar installations.
  2. Calculate Your Energy Needs: Determine how much energy you need to offset your electric bill. This will guide the size and capacity of your solar panel system.
  3. Choose the Right Materials: Purchase high-efficiency solar panels that perform well in lower temperatures. Look for panels with a lower temperature coefficient.
  4. Select a Suitable Location: Choose a location for your solar panels that receives maximum sunlight exposure, even during winter months. South-facing roofs are generally best.
  5. Build a Secure Mounting System: Ensure your solar panels are securely mounted to withstand snow and ice. Use robust frames and consider adjustable mounts that can tilt the panels to capture more sunlight.
  6. Install the Panels: Follow the manufacturer’s guidelines for installing the panels. Ensure connections are tight and waterproof to prevent any damage due to cold weather.
  7. Connect the Inverter and Battery: Once the panels are installed, connect them to the inverter and battery system, allowing you to store energy for use when needed.
  8. Monitor Performance: Use monitoring tools to check the performance of your solar system regularly, especially during colder months.

Practical Tips for Building in Cold Weather

  • Select Quality Components: Invest in high-quality panels and batteries that are designed to perform in cold conditions.
  • Regular Maintenance: Keep your solar panels free from snow and ice buildup to maximize sunlight exposure.
  • Insulation Matters: Ensure your home is well-insulated to reduce energy consumption, thus complementing your solar energy production.
  • Use Reflective Materials: In certain setups, using reflective materials around the panels can help redirect sunlight towards them.

Frequently Asked Questions (FAQ)

1. Can I install solar panels myself in winter?

Yes, but you need to take extra precautions for safety and ensure that the installation is secure to handle snow and ice.

2. Do solar panels work in the cold?

Yes, solar panels can be more efficient in cold weather as they operate better in cooler temperatures, but they require maximum exposure to sunlight.

3. What maintenance do solar panels require in winter?

Regularly remove snow and ice from the panels and check connections for any signs of wear or damage due to cold weather.
